[發(fā)明專利]基于頻域方向?yàn)V波器的遞歸預(yù)測(cè)圖像壓縮方法有效
| 申請(qǐng)?zhí)枺?/td> | 201710116017.7 | 申請(qǐng)日: | 2017-03-01 |
| 公開(公告)號(hào): | CN106952314B | 公開(公告)日: | 2019-06-21 |
| 發(fā)明(設(shè)計(jì))人: | 張靜;李珊珊;李云松;吳仁堅(jiān) | 申請(qǐng)(專利權(quán))人: | 西安電子科技大學(xué) |
| 主分類號(hào): | G06T9/00 | 分類號(hào): | G06T9/00 |
| 代理公司: | 陜西電子工業(yè)專利中心 61205 | 代理人: | 王品華;朱紅星 |
| 地址: | 710071 陜*** | 國省代碼: | 陜西;61 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 基于 方向?yàn)V波器 遞歸 預(yù)測(cè) 圖像 壓縮 方法 | ||
1.基于頻域方向?yàn)V波器的遞歸預(yù)測(cè)圖像壓縮方法,包括:
(1)設(shè)計(jì)原型方向?yàn)V波器:
(1a)利用商用軟件matlab中的函數(shù)freqspace確定二維頻域響應(yīng)空間[f1,f2];
(1b)設(shè)定原型方向?yàn)V波器的傅立葉頻譜支撐域參數(shù)K,其中K取值為正實(shí)數(shù);
(1c)以支撐域參數(shù)K和頻域響應(yīng)空間[f1,f2]限定傅立葉頻譜支撐范圍,生成原型方向?yàn)V波器的頻域響應(yīng)函數(shù)Hd,該頻域響應(yīng)函數(shù)Hd的取值按如下條件確定:
如果((Kf1-f2<0)&&(K×f1+f2<0))||((K×f1-f2>0)&&(K×f1+f2>0))成立,則Hd取值為0,否則,Hd取值為1,其中,&&代表邏輯與操作,||代表邏輯或操作;
(1d)利用窗函數(shù)設(shè)計(jì)時(shí)域二維有限長單位脈沖響應(yīng)數(shù)字濾波器h,其中h的頻域響應(yīng)函數(shù)為Hd;
(1e)利用商用軟件matlab中的freqz2函數(shù),根據(jù)步驟(1d)中的h生成原型方向?yàn)V波器H;
(2)利用雙立方插值法將步驟(1e)中的原型方向?yàn)V波器H逆時(shí)針旋轉(zhuǎn)不同的角度θ,即參照傅立葉頻譜支撐域參數(shù)K,依次旋轉(zhuǎn)θ≈i×α的角度,得到一組L個(gè)方向的方向?yàn)V波器,其中,其中α=2arctan(1/K),i取值為0~L-1范圍內(nèi)的整數(shù),L取值為8~72之間的正整數(shù);
(3)從自然圖像集中讀入一幅大小為M×M、后綴為.raw格式的原始灰度圖像,其中,M表示原始灰度圖像的寬度和高度,×表示相乘操作;
(4)對(duì)原始灰度圖像數(shù)據(jù)進(jìn)行紋理方向判斷:
(4a)對(duì)原始灰度圖像數(shù)據(jù)進(jìn)行高通濾波,濾除圖像的主要低頻分量,得到高頻圖像數(shù)據(jù);
(4b)將高頻圖像數(shù)據(jù)均勻分成大小為N×N的高頻圖像數(shù)據(jù)塊,讀取這些高頻圖像數(shù)據(jù)塊,并將讀取次數(shù)k初始化為1,其中,N表示高頻圖像數(shù)據(jù)塊的寬度和高度,取值為4或8,×表示相乘操作;
(4c)利用步驟(2)得到的L個(gè)方向的方向?yàn)V波器對(duì)第k個(gè)高頻圖像數(shù)據(jù)塊進(jìn)行頻域?yàn)V波,計(jì)算每個(gè)方向?yàn)V波后的傅立葉頻譜能量和S0,S1,…,Si,…,SL-1,其中i=0,1,…L-1,并按如下步驟檢測(cè)出原始圖像數(shù)據(jù)塊的紋理主方向:
(4c1)計(jì)算每個(gè)方向?yàn)V波后的傅立葉頻譜能量和S0,S1,…,Si,…,SL-1中的最大值Smax:
Smax=max{S0,S1,…,Si,…,SL-1}
(4c2)根據(jù)Smax確定圖像頻域方向性角度
(4c3)根據(jù)圖像的空域方向性與其傅立葉頻譜方向性存在的正交關(guān)系,得到高頻圖像數(shù)據(jù)塊的紋理主方向的角度為進(jìn)而得到原始灰度圖像數(shù)據(jù)塊的紋理方向的角度為
(4d)判斷是否完成對(duì)所有高頻圖像數(shù)據(jù)塊的紋理方向讀取,如果是,則執(zhí)行步驟(5),否則,k自增1,返回步驟(4c);
(5)對(duì)步驟(3)中的原始灰度圖像數(shù)據(jù)進(jìn)行上下各三行,左右各三列的邊界擴(kuò)展,得到大小為(M+6)×(M+6)的擴(kuò)展圖像數(shù)據(jù),并將數(shù)據(jù)讀取地址初始化為擴(kuò)展圖像數(shù)據(jù)地址起始位置;
(6)從數(shù)據(jù)讀取地址開始,對(duì)擴(kuò)展圖像數(shù)據(jù)以大小為(N+3)×(N+3)塊為單位進(jìn)行讀取:
(6a)初始化一個(gè)(N+3)×(N+3)二維矩陣來存儲(chǔ)塊數(shù)據(jù),并將讀取次數(shù)i初始化為1;
(6b)從數(shù)據(jù)讀取地址開始,讀取N+3個(gè)數(shù)據(jù),并將其賦值給二維矩陣的第一行;
(6c)將數(shù)據(jù)讀取地址增加M+6,并將i自增1;
(6d)判斷i是否等于N+3,如果是,則完成塊數(shù)據(jù)的讀取,否則,返回步驟(6b);
(7)根據(jù)讀取的塊數(shù)據(jù)建立馬爾可夫預(yù)測(cè)模型:
(7a)依照步驟(4)得到的紋理主方向,對(duì)塊數(shù)據(jù)中不包括上邊三行、左邊三列的各個(gè)像素點(diǎn),利用與該紋理方向上鄰近的若干參考像素點(diǎn)建立如下遞歸馬爾可夫預(yù)測(cè)模型:
u(i,j)=ρ1u1(i,j)+ρ2u2(i,j)+ρ3u3(i,j)+ρ4u4(i,j)+e(i,j),i、j=0,1,2…N
其中u(i,j)表示坐標(biāo)為(i,j)的像素點(diǎn)的預(yù)測(cè)值,u1(i,j),u2(i,j),u3(i,j),u4(i,j)分別表示四個(gè)參考像素的灰度值,ρ1,ρ2,ρ3,ρ4分別為四個(gè)參考像素的權(quán)值系數(shù),e(i,j)為白噪聲;
(7b)利用最小二乘估計(jì)的方法,估計(jì)遞歸馬爾可夫預(yù)測(cè)模型中參考像素的權(quán)值系數(shù):
(8)塊數(shù)據(jù)的預(yù)測(cè):
(8a)對(duì)塊數(shù)據(jù)中不包括上邊三行、左邊三列的各個(gè)像素,根據(jù)步驟(7)中已建立的遞歸馬爾可夫預(yù)測(cè)模型進(jìn)行預(yù)測(cè),得到預(yù)測(cè)值矩陣;
(8b)將塊數(shù)據(jù)中不包括上邊三行、左邊三列的各個(gè)像素灰度值,與其在預(yù)測(cè)值矩陣中對(duì)應(yīng)的預(yù)測(cè)值進(jìn)行相減,得到差值矩陣R,并對(duì)差值矩陣R進(jìn)行離散余弦變換DCT得到變換系數(shù)矩陣T,然后對(duì)變換系數(shù)矩陣T進(jìn)行量化、熵編碼,得到壓縮碼;
(8c)對(duì)壓縮碼進(jìn)行解碼、逆量化、逆DCT變換,得到恢復(fù)后的差值矩陣R′,并將R′與差值矩陣R相加得到重建值矩陣,根據(jù)重建值矩陣對(duì)擴(kuò)展圖像數(shù)據(jù)塊中的相應(yīng)地址處像素值進(jìn)行更新;
(9)判斷是否完成所有塊數(shù)據(jù)的預(yù)測(cè),如果是,則結(jié)束壓縮,否則,數(shù)據(jù)讀取地址跳變?yōu)橄乱粋€(gè)塊數(shù)據(jù)的起始地址,返回步驟(6)。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于西安電子科技大學(xué),未經(jīng)西安電子科技大學(xué)許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201710116017.7/1.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。
- 圖像編碼裝置、圖像編碼方法、圖像譯碼裝置、圖像譯碼方法、程序以及記錄介質(zhì)
- 圖像編碼裝置、圖像編碼方法、圖像譯碼裝置、圖像譯碼方法
- 圖像編碼裝置、圖像編碼方法、圖像譯碼裝置、圖像譯碼方法
- 基于時(shí)間序列預(yù)測(cè)模型適用性量化的預(yù)測(cè)模型選擇方法
- 圖像編碼裝置、圖像編碼方法、圖像譯碼裝置、圖像譯碼方法
- 分類預(yù)測(cè)方法及裝置、預(yù)測(cè)模型訓(xùn)練方法及裝置
- 幀內(nèi)預(yù)測(cè)的方法及裝置
- 圖像預(yù)測(cè)方法及裝置、電子設(shè)備和存儲(chǔ)介質(zhì)
- 文本預(yù)測(cè)方法、裝置以及電子設(shè)備
- 模型融合方法、預(yù)測(cè)方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)





